>I don't know about radius, but on Ascend, there is a considerable
>difference. MPP must be used for any multilink connection. PPP will only
>allow one connection.
>
>There is another problem involved with Ascend to Livingston Connections.
>An ascend dialing into a PM3, the ascend must have MPP turned on to do a
>multilink session. Unfortunately, the PM3 does not support the MPP
>protocol fully. I will allow an inital 2 channel connection, but if one
>channel drops, the ascend will no be able to pick up the second channel
>again unless both channels are dropped. Ascend says they will not support
>BACP and Livingston says no to MPP. Now that they are both owned by
>Lucent, we'll see.
